diff --git a/browser/base/content/browser-sync.js b/browser/base/content/browser-sync.js index 0d2f8290986b..c3ce9b2b68ae 100644 --- a/browser/base/content/browser-sync.js +++ b/browser/base/content/browser-sync.js @@ -787,19 +787,18 @@ var gSync = { const fragment = document.createDocumentFragment(); const state = UIState.get(); - if ( - state.status == UIState.STATUS_SIGNED_IN && - this.sendTabTargets.length > 0 - ) { - this._appendSendTabDeviceList( - fragment, - createDeviceNodeFn, - url, - title, - multiselected - ); - } else if (state.status == UIState.STATUS_SIGNED_IN) { - this._appendSendTabSingleDevice(fragment, createDeviceNodeFn); + if (state.status == UIState.STATUS_SIGNED_IN) { + if (this.sendTabTargets.length > 0) { + this._appendSendTabDeviceList( + fragment, + createDeviceNodeFn, + url, + title, + multiselected + ); + } else { + this._appendSendTabSingleDevice(fragment, createDeviceNodeFn); + } } else if ( state.status == UIState.STATUS_NOT_VERIFIED || state.status == UIState.STATUS_LOGIN_FAILED diff --git a/browser/components/customizableui/content/panelUI.inc.xul b/browser/components/customizableui/content/panelUI.inc.xul index 65c30e1e2803..7051ccaf2fb7 100644 --- a/browser/components/customizableui/content/panelUI.inc.xul +++ b/browser/components/customizableui/content/panelUI.inc.xul @@ -785,7 +785,7 @@ + oncommand="gSync.openPrefsFromFxaMenu('send_tab', this);"/>